Новости Joomla

Как тестировать Joomla PHP-разработчику? Компонент Patch tester.

👩‍💻 Как тестировать Joomla PHP-разработчику? Компонент Patch tester.Joomla - open source PHP-фреймворк с готовой админкой. Его основная разработка ведётся на GitHub. Для того, чтобы международному сообществу разработчиков было удобнее тестировать Pull Requests был создан компонент Patch Tester, который позволяет "накатить" на текущую установку Joomla именно те изменения, которые необходимо протестировать. На стороне инфраструктуры Joomla для каждого PR собираются готовые пакеты, в которых находится ядро + предложенные изменения. В каждом PR обычно находятся инструкции по тестированию: куда зайти, что нажать, ожидаемый результат. Тестировщики могут предположить дополнительные сценарии, исходя из своего опыта и найти баги, о которых сообщить разработчику. Или не найти, и тогда улучшение или исправление ошибки быстрее войдёт в ядро Joomla. Напомню, что для того, чтобы PR вошёл в ядро Joomla нужны минимум 2 положительных теста от 2 участников сообщества, кроме автора. Видео на YouTubeВидео на VK ВидеоВидео на RuTubeКомпонент на GitHub https://github.com/joomla-extensions/patchtester@joomlafeed#joomla #php #webdev #community

0 Пользователей и 1 Гость просматривают эту тему.
  • 4 Ответов
  • 1495 Просмотров
*

robotwerder

  • Захожу иногда
  • 248
  • 6 / 1
Раньше на этом же шаблоне такой проблемы не было и сказать точно когда она всплыла сложно, скорее всего когда мигрировал с 1.0.15 на.1.5.14
в общем суть в том, что в тех местах где мне необходимо некоторые модули перестали отображаться:( а к примеру на главной и ещё на ряде страниц они прекрасно работают. Позиция right. Ничего что могло бы конфликтовать на этих страничках я не нашел.
Конструкция правой колонки такая
Код
<?php
if (mosCountModules( "right" )) {
?>
бла бла бла

<td width="200" valign="top"><?php mosLoadModules ( 'right' ); ?></td>

бла бла бла
<?php
}
?>

если оставляю только лишь <?php mosLoadModules ( 'right' ); ?> то в тех местах где мне нужно правая колонка полностью отсутствует, а в местах где она раньше была она по прежнему присутствует и все модули в ней имеются:(
Подскажите пожалуйстаз как выйти из ситуации?!
*

MuraDweb

  • Захожу иногда
  • 267
  • 124 / 1
Плагин Режима совместимости Legacy включен?
А, ещё лучше подправить шаб под J!1.5 (читаем FAQ)
Яндекс.Деньги: 41001423568435
Webmoney: R 377548789269 | Z 421465848009 | E 126339514076 | U 413960261029
-
А, Вы читали ? Правила форума | FAQ J! 1.5 | FAQ J! 1.0
*

klubnichkaaa

  • Захожу иногда
  • 302
  • 16 / 2
привет
Цитировать
<td width="200" valign="top"><?php mosLoadModules ( 'right' ); ?></td>
width="200" чего % или px попробуйте поставить значение и посмотрите! Я не говорю что это поможет но всё же! width="200px" так как у вас всё в таблицах! и не в CSS задано!
Делай с другими то же, что они собираются сделать с тобой: бей первым.
*

robotwerder

  • Захожу иногда
  • 248
  • 6 / 1
да. legacy включен !
а, еще, подскажите уважаемый как будет выглядеть конструкция

         if (mosCountModules( "right" )) {
            ?>
                     бла бла бла

                        <td width="200" valign="top"><?php mosLoadModules ( 'right' ); ?></td>

                     бла бла бла
            <?php
         }
в j1.5 / ведь вывод модулей там имеет <jdoc:include type="modules" name="........." />такой вид ?!
просто в шаблоне в нескольких местах вывод организован подобным образом а в PHP я не спец
*

MuraDweb

  • Захожу иногда
  • 267
  • 124 / 1
Код: php
<?php if($this->countModules('right')) : ?>
бла бла бла
<td width="200px" valign="top"><jdoc:include type="modules" name="right" /></td>
        бла бла бла
<?php } ?>

По условиям вывода в шаблонах J!1.5 есть отличная тема http://joomlaforum.ru/index.php/topic,67278.0.html

ИМХО потихонечку лучше перевести шаблон в нативный вид под J!1.5 ;)
« Последнее редактирование: 04.06.2010, 12:10:58 от MuraDweb »
Яндекс.Деньги: 41001423568435
Webmoney: R 377548789269 | Z 421465848009 | E 126339514076 | U 413960261029
-
А, Вы читали ? Правила форума | FAQ J! 1.5 | FAQ J! 1.0
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

Отображаются emoji в мета тегах как 4 знака ?

Автор safronoff343

Ответов: 10
Просмотров: 4682
Последний ответ 01.08.2020, 18:59:33
от SeBun
Не отображаются материалы и ссылки на сайте (joomla 1.5)

Автор МарияЛ

Ответов: 1
Просмотров: 1731
Последний ответ 17.03.2017, 20:33:56
от voland
Не отображаются keywords и description, прописанные через админку

Автор Apple_pie

Ответов: 5
Просмотров: 3389
Последний ответ 13.07.2016, 08:19:45
от Наталюся
Не отображаются сообщения при регистрации и входе

Автор hogik

Ответов: 0
Просмотров: 1441
Последний ответ 02.04.2016, 13:33:53
от hogik
Не отображаются meta tags

Автор Boroda92

Ответов: 1
Просмотров: 1481
Последний ответ 29.10.2014, 00:38:40
от darkghost